From d9b11b97844de2524a1373c8a0ba5d1576674a8a Mon Sep 17 00:00:00 2001 From: Adrien de Peretti Date: Mon, 15 Sep 2025 19:17:08 +0200 Subject: [PATCH] fix(medusa): Use the correct boolean validator (#13510) --- .../medusa/src/api/store/shipping-options/validators.ts |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/packages/medusa/src/api/store/shipping-options/validators.ts b/packages/medusa/src/api/store/shipping-options/validators.ts index 0267919c02..13508e7727 100644 --- a/packages/medusa/src/api/store/shipping-options/validators.ts +++ b/packages/medusa/src/api/store/shipping-options/validators.ts @@ -1,5 +1,8 @@ import { z } from "zod" -import { applyAndAndOrOperators } from "../../utils/common-validators" +import { + applyAndAndOrOperators, + booleanString, +} from "../../utils/common-validators" import { createFindParams, createSelectParams } from "../../utils/validators" export const StoreGetShippingOptionsParams = createSelectParams() @@ -7,7 +10,7 @@ export const StoreGetShippingOptionsParams = createSelectParams() export const StoreGetShippingOptionsFields = z .object({ cart_id: z.string(), - is_return: z.boolean().optional(), + is_return: booleanString().optional(), }) .strict()